Cinder block repair services involve fixing and restoring damaged or deteriorated cinder block structures to ensure they remain strong and functional. Over time, cinder blocks can develop cracks, chips, or crumbling sections due to weather exposure, settling, or general wear and tear. Repair work typically includes filling cracks, replacing broken blocks, and sealing joints to prevent further damage. Skilled service providers use specialized techniques to reinforce the integrity of the wall or structure, helping to maintain its appearance and safety.
These repair services address a variety of common problems that homeowners may encounter. Cracks in cinder block walls can compromise the stability of foundations or retaining walls, while crumbling or loose blocks can lead to structural failure if left unattended. Water infiltration is another frequent issue, as damaged or missing mortar joints allow moisture to seep in, which can cause further deterioration and mold growth. Repairing these issues promptly can prevent more extensive and costly repairs down the line, preserving the property's value and safety.

The overview below groups typical Cinder Block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Powell,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or cinder block repairs in Powell, OH range from $250 to $600. Many routine patching and crack repairs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.
Moderate Projects - Medium-sized repairs, such as replacing sections of damaged blocks or sealing larger cracks, generally cost between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common for homeowners addressing more noticeable issues.
Large Repairs or Replacements - Extensive repairs or partial replacements can range from $1,500 to $3,000, especially when multiple sections or structural repairs are involved. Fewer projects push into this higher tier, typically for significant damage.
Full Wall or Structural Replacement - Complete cinder block wall replacements or major structural repairs can cost $3,000 to $5,000 or more. These larger, more complex projects are less frequent but necessary for severe damage or foundational issues.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es cinder block damage that needs repair? Damage to cinder blocks can result from issues like settling, moisture infiltration, or physical impacts that weaken the structure and require professional repair services.
How do professionals typically repair cinder block cracks or holes? Repair methods often involve filling cracks with specialized mortar or sealants, replacing damaged blocks, and ensuring the structure is properly reinforced to prevent future issues.
Are there different types of cinder block repairs based on the damage? Yes, repairs can vary from simple crack filling to complete replacement of damaged blocks, depending on the extent and nature of the damage observed.
What signs indicate that cinder block repair might be needed? Visible cracks, crumbling mortar, bulging blocks, or water seepage are common signs that a property may require professional cinder block repair services.
